Engineering}, month = {Mar}, note = {To take a step of the research for the elastic-plastic problems authors take the torsion of a shaft of a square cross section which is easier in the application of the numerical analysis. To obtain the approximate solution within the elastic limit the fundamental partial differential equation of the torsion can be transformed into the finite-difference equation and to get better accuracy the relaxation method applied. By placing the square net over the cross section of the bar authors obtain the resultant shearing stress and the twisting moment within elastic limit and over it by the application of the relaxation method and descrives the elastic-plastic boundary when a plastic deformation takes place somewhere in its cross section., 紀要論文}, pages = {63--76}, title = {正方形断面棒の弾塑性捩り}, year = {1972} }
